Grizzly

No.1 http://www.negative-camber.org/crispyrx7/dash.htm it can be done with the steering wheel in place but tbh for what it is i found it much better to take the Wheel off to get a bit of access. Just remember the Top cowl and clocks slide back towards you Not Up!! its a common mistake and will brake all the clips on the top dome.

No.2 Yeh its all one cluster unit, so have a look while clocks are out, bit of a heads up. Try unplugging and plugging in the clocks as the connections get dirty and they start to play up.

No.3 If its a Jap import they don\'t have rear fogs as such but if you mean a UK spec one the Fog light is in the bumper next to the rear No plate and if you look close you will see the red cross head screws you need to remove.
